What's Hotshotting?
Hotshotting includes using smaller trucks or vans, usually hitched to trailers, to transport goods quickly and efficiently. These vehicles are typically owner-operated, allowing for greater flexibility when it comes to scheduling and route planning. Unlike traditional long-haul trucking, hotshot carriers handle shorter distances and prioritize speed over volume. This makes hotshotting a perfect selection for companies that require speedy or just-in-time deliveries.
Benefits of Hotshotting
Speed: The primary advantage of hotshotting is speed. With a smaller and more agile fleet, hotshot carriers can cover shorter distances in less time. This makes them an attractive option for industries like oil and gas, building, and manufacturing, the place time-sensitive deliveries are essential.
Flexibility: Hotshot carriers can adapt quickly to altering circumstances. They are often dispatched at a moment's notice and might navigate by means of city areas or distant locations with ease. This level of flexibility is usually unattainable for bigger, traditional carriers.
Cost-Efficient: For certain types of freight, hotshotting can be more price-effective than using bigger trucks. Hotshot carriers can supply competitive rates, especially for small to mid-sized shipments.
Various Cargo: Hotshot carriers can transport a wide variety of cargo, including building equipment, industrial machinery, auto parts, and more. This versatility makes them a valuable asset for companies with diverse shipping needs.
Challenges of Hotshotting
While hotshotting presents quite a few advantages, it additionally comes with its fair share of challenges:
Limited Capacity: Hotshot trucks have smaller cargo capacities compared to traditional freight trucks. This generally is a limitation for businesses with large-volume shipments.
Upkeep Prices: The wear and tear on hotshot vehicles may be significant on account of their high-speed, high-demand operations. Upkeep prices may be higher as a result.
Regulatory Compliance: Hotshot carriers are topic to the identical regulatory requirements as traditional trucking corporations, including licensing, insurance, and safety standards.
Competition: The rising widespreadity of hotshotting has led to increased competition in the industry, which can make it challenging for new entrants to ascertain themselves.
